Ancient humans evolved to be better teachers as technology advanced

June 5, 2025
in Health News
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ter


As technology progressed, humans also got better at passing on skills to others

English Heritage/Heritage Images/Getty Images

An analysis of more than 3 million years of human evolution shows that communication and technology developed in lockstep. As ancient humans came up with more advanced stone tools and other technologies, they also improved their communication and teaching skills, in order to pass their newfound abilities onto the next generation – and this enabled more technological progress.

“We have a scenario for the evolution of the mode of cultural transmission in human evolution,” says Francesco d’Errico at the University of Bordeaux…
